Over the past 28 years, there have been 23 property sales recorded in the SK2 5QU postcode area. The highest sale price reached £485,000, while the most recent sale was for a semi-detached house sold in November 2023 for £297,500.
The estimated average property value in SK2 5QU currently stands at £412,693, which is approximately 38.4% higher than the city average, indicating a potentially more desirable or in-demand location.
In terms of size, the average price per square metre is approximately £3,745.
Property prices in SK2 5QU have risen by 4.6% over the past year , with a total increase of 38% over the past five years, and a long-term rise of 83.3% over the past decade.
The most common type of property sold in the area is semi-detached, making up around 83% of transactions , followed by detached and other.
Housing in SK2 5QU is predominantly owner-occupied, with an estimated 91% of homes being lived in by the owners.
